Transaction 6866d1cff6a724aacd9616b69563c6ee0dc2b0e0efcb4312a3164d7b487e23aa
1 Input
1 Output
-
6866d1cff6a724aacd9616b69563c6ee0dc2b0e0efcb4312a3164d7b487e23aa:0
- value
- 3839800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b4aae1a5583d6d8782b1cd4aaa7171f0ec2c3bf OP_EQUAL
- address
- 3EPXK57dzTkkvJ9oFqyrEW7PbSyS7sYuWu